People who have developed a dependency to drugs or alcohol have the tendency to be impacted by resistance to the substance. Resistance takes place when an individual is no longer affected by the very same quantity of a medication and needs to take even more of it to feel the same results. When trying to identify drug dependency symptoms in those around you, behavioral adjustments may be the largest clue. For instance, individuals who are newly influenced by medicine dependency might start falling behind in school or work performance, or might not have rate of interest in tasks they utilized to enjoy. They may also no more pay much attention to their appearance, or could neglect their health and wellness. Individuals with developing dependencies might also come to be secretive in an initiative to hide their addictions, specifically if they are not ready to encounter their disorder yet.

The National Institute on Substance Abuse (NIDA) supplies a comprehensive definition of drug addiction, stating, "addiction is defined as a chronic, relapsing mind disease that is identified by uncontrollable drug looking for and also usage, in spite of dangerous repercussions." Addiction is identified as a mind condition due to the fact that medications literally create adjustments to the brain. This may be a hard concept to realize, yet it's true. Exactly how does it work?
Medicines which are habit forming work in the mind by generating pleasure (understood in science as incentive). They set off the mind's benefit system, and interrupt the typical messaging flow. Dopamine, a neurotransmitter in the mind, can be found in the areas of the brain which are in charge of feeling, sensations of satisfaction, cognition, inspiration, and also motion. When individuals take medications, this benefit system becomes overstimulated, typically from an excess accumulation of dopamine. This creates the thrill sensation individuals tend to yearn for when abusing substances. With time, and with extended abuse of medicines, a person's mind re-wires itself to seek this brand-new method of producing incentive. Essentially, the brain makes an individual long for that thrill sensation over and over.

People who could have developed dependency will profit most from extensive therapy. Getting enjoyed ones the assistance they need may be tough, though. Commonly, addicted people are not ready to admit they have a substance use condition, as well as this can provide a trouble for speaking with them about it. When challenging a person concerning addiction, be sure to do it in a risk-free, open setting, and to utilize soft tones. Allow plenty of time, and aim to stay clear of public places so the person does not really feel assaulted or embarrassed. Most of all, let the person know you care, as well as tension the relevance of therapy in their recuperation from addiction.
